Examples in this article can be used with the sample Adventure Works DW 2020 Power BI Desktop model. I hope you will find it! Attend online or watch the recordings of this Power BI specific conference, which includes 130+ sessions, 130+ speakers, product managers, MVPs, and experts. Calculating time duration in Days, Hours, Minutes and Seconds in Microsoft Power BI using I recently found myself in a situation, when I needed to calculate a date difference between two datetime values in Power BI excluding weekends. Again, if you would like to reuse this code in your own work, all you need do Why are physically impossible and logically impossible concepts considered separate in terms of probability?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Yet, this is not perfect, because the value displayed for Previous Sales is much larger than the one displayed for Sales Amount. We will create year and relative year dimensions. First open Power query editor. wer bi date difference between two columns, Power bi date difference between two tables, power bi date difference between two rows, power bi date difference between two in same column, Power bi date difference between two columns, Power bi date difference between two rows, Power bi date difference between two in the same column, Power bi measure subtract + 7 useful examples. I've just checked but the error still appear unfortunatly even when I change the format.. I am working on a report where I have to calculate the difference between two dates (a specific date, and today) then show the resulat in the following format 00years - 00months - 00days. First open Power query editor. Whereas the two dates are in same column, and i want to calcualte the number of days two chronolgy adjacent dates when there are multiple dates values, Web7.8K views 1 year ago DAX Tutorial In this video, we explained How to calculate difference between two dates in Power BI. ***** Related Links*****. Example. Hello Guys, I need to calucate difference between 2 dates and the output should be in hours and minutes. Power BI DAX: date slicer filter does not affect custom measure that uses CALCULATE. Using calculated tables, this is as easy as creating a new calculated table that is a shallow copy of the original Date: Previous Date = ALLNOBLANKROW ( 'Date' ) Copy Conventions # 1 Now that you have the table, you need to setup the relationships. I have used DATEDIFF function but because one of the date could be blank and/or the difference Start Date is less than End Date) I am unable to calcuate the output using DATEDIFF function. by anyone using Power BI. Generate a list of dates between start and enddate, remove weekends and holidays. Time intelligence calculations are among the most required functionalities in any data model. Time difference (Seconds) = DATEDIFF ( SalesData [OrderDate 2], SalesData [ShipDate 2], SECOND ) Example: Date1 - Today () Date2 - 08/19/2020. Here we will see how to calculate date difference between the two months in power bi. Not the answer you're looking for? Right click on the table, select "New Column", in the formula section you can use, Column Name = 1. Web7.8K views 1 year ago DAX Tutorial In this video, we explained How to calculate difference between two dates in Power BI. Right click on the table, select "New Column", in the formula section you can use Column Name = 1. To get the model, see DAX sample model. Here we will see the power bi date difference between the two in the same column in power bi. And in the event table, you can see date of event occured and also it hold another field i.e. The second part of the formula, which is the IF statement, simply uses the variables we created and specifically identifies the first date as 0. To calculate the difference between the two dates we will use the power query(M code), not Dax. step is only separated from the second step to make it clearer to understand. Labels: Interesting Links Need Help To do this, create a measure using DAX as seen in the diagram and code below. You could just create a column: column = [Time column1]- [Time column2], then change the new new column into time type. Do I need DAX formula's? The DAX code can also work We will create a Calculated column which will hold the age of the person was when the event occured. Hopefully, this should fix all your test cases Fingers Crossed !! For this click on the modelling tab-> new column from the ribbon in power bi desktop. Here we will see how to find the date difference between two rows in power bi desktop. So, I suggest you try this: ('Psych data'[Date received] - 'Psych data'[Date sent])*1, Hi@sammi1244thanks for pointing that out. The reason is the disproportionate time period not a decrease in sales. Hi, Will this work if Date2= Table[ColumnDate]. I am working on a report where I have to calculate the difference between two dates (a specific date, and today) then show the resulat in the following format 00years - 00months - 00days. Now I have created a table visualization, where I have added name, Date(event), Event, and age( calculated column). Here is how the function is used to calculate duration between order date and order completed date to create a new column Duration with duration between 2 dates in days. 3. I am using MIN because an incident may have: - But many Datwijzig (We only take the first one). What are other options I can use? The DATEDIFF function is a simple function that you can use to calculate the time difference between two dates in Power BI. Potentially could be optimized somehow. The DatesInPeriod function in DAX will give you all dates within a period. Year-to-date, same period last year, comparison of different time periods are probably the most requested features of any BI solution. Get Dynamic Date Difference in Power BI. 02-03-2017 02:46 AM. So click on the measure in the ribbon, then write the Dax measure is: Lets say we have two tables one contact table and the Event table. the total duration in minutes. I tried, Order Completion Time in days = DATEDIFF(Min('Order Table' [Order Date]), Max('Invoice Table' [Invoice Date]), DAY) and then filtered shipment_num = 1 in the visual table. To get the model, see DAX sample model. However, I have projects where the Actual Gate meeting hasn't been held yet so the date field is currently blank, and for these projects the result is like 42,796. Thank you for taking the time to read my question. In this article, we have provided many examples for DATEDIFF function in Power BI to calculate: Power BI DATEDIFF in Years Power BI DATEDIFF in Quarter Power BI date DATEDIFF in Months Power BI date And also we will discuss the below points: Here we will see how to calculate the date difference between two date columns i.e. Asking for help, clarification, or responding to other answers. How to Calculate hours difference between two date calculate the difference between two time in HH:MM:SS. I have tried to use DATEDIFF Function which works as measure but I do not know how to include only working hours in this case. I recently found myself in a situation, when I needed to calculate a date difference between two datetime values in Power BI excluding weekends. Which date this is? You have customer Order Dates and Ship Dates and want to know how long it Go to modelling tab -> New column from the ribbon in power bi desktop. Find out more about the online and in person events happening in March! Or do I just need to download the most recent update? As you may notice, our formulas work well as intended, we see that Sales Amt PM for December 17th, matches Sales Amt for November 17th. Is there a proper earth ground point in this switch box? Create a In a table with data related to projects, I'm evaluating 2 date columns - Planned Gate meeting date (my Start Date) and Actual Gate meeting date (my End Date). In this scenario, you have a dataset which only has some fields along with a articles that have demonstrated how to approach this. I tried te following example: Date1 - Date2 This does not give me the difference this gives me a weird date value. Find out more about the February 2023 update. Maybe you just switched the two date columns (parameters) in the function. WebCalculate the Time between Two Dates in Power BI Calculating the time between two dates is a rather simple task.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. Go to Solution. Duration.Days ( [completed date]- [order date]) This works with datetime value as well. If there are multiple fact tables, then the number of inactive relationships grows and the model becomes messy. Building a model where the user can choose two different periods using a slicer. I have applied the measure but it takes too long to to apply when using it in a table. !Thank you so much!I never did a calculated column before when there are two tables. 07-19-2016 08:05 AM @Anonymous You can create a calculated column. Next I have create the table visual and I have added order date field, ship date field, days between Calculated column and diff Calculated column. Hi Michael, if i understand your question right, what i would do is i would create another column that handles the situation that translates seconds to 2345 and ensure i assign a usable value to it.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. She likes to share her technical expertise in EnjoySharePoint.com and SPGuides.com. Can you help me take this a step further? 0. The period can be one of these: Day, Month, Quarter, Year. Hot I found many solution on the community forum, eg. We will create year and relative year dimensions. DATEDIFF function. For this, we will create a calculated column in the power bi desktop. I seem to have Token Literal error on this formula: diff row = [MRR]-LOOKUPVALUE(Data[MRR],Data[Account Name],[Account Name],Data[Report Date],CALCULATE(Max(Data[Report Date]),FILTER(Data,Data[Account Name]=EARLIER(Data[Account Name])&&Data[Report Date]
Power BI. as a calculated column instead of a measure. I have 2 dates one is stored inside my date and for other date I am using calculated column in order to store the end date into that, how an I calculate the difference in time period between those dates, I need the date period between all those dates is that possible with DAX? Looking for more Power BI tips, tricks & How can I use calculated column inside my DAX and also I dont have a calender table inside my database. DAX is a common task most Analysts would undertake in their daily work with Power However, I have made this How to Calculate hours difference between two dates/times taking into consideration working hours. Go to Solution. Web12.2 How to find difference between dates in Power BI (Power Query) | Power BI Tutorial for BeginnerPower BI Desktop will be shown in this video. THIS WORKED!! Result to show => 1 year, 9 months and 19 days. Share Assuming you have two columns, Start Date and End Date, you'll need a measure along the lines of: No of Days = SUMX('Table', DATEDIFF('Table'[StartDate], 'Table'[EndDate], DAY)) You can of course, add a calculated column using DATEDIFF if your data structure supports it, and then create a measure on that references that column. calculation. Once power query editor open, Click on the Add column tab. Currently I am using the DATEDIF function inside Excel then Then count the number of days left in your list.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, how to calculate monthly budget till current day in power bi Desktop, Power BI - DAX measure to calculate sales first 31 days - 'DATEADD' expects a contiguous selection, POwer pivot Calculated field using aggregates, How to calculate total sales as of first day of the current month as Previous month sales in power BI, Dax to Calculate the Date difference from Due date, POWER BI Measure for dividing total sales by each person by total sales. as follows. To learn more, see our tips on writing great answers. I am trying this but no luck . and then filtered shipment_num = 1 in the visual table. The Read more, DAX creates a blank row to guarantee that results are accurate even if a regular relationship is invalid. You may like the following Power Bi tutorials: In this power bi tutorial, we discussed power bi date difference. Sorry silly question here: I need to get the number of years between the hire date and Today's date and the result should be in a single value. will leave links to them in the next steps at the end of this article. To demonstrate this, I will approach it from the two different business scenarios Currently I am using the DATEDIFfunction inside Excel then importing the result in my Power BI report, but everyday I have to open the exel file in order to get the new update then refresh my report in Power BI. Time difference (Seconds) = DATEDIFF ( SalesData [OrderDate 2], SalesData [ShipDate 2], SECOND ) To do this, we need to create a calculated column using the DATEDIFF DAX function as seen in the diagram and DAX syntax below. Find out more about the February 2023 update. I tried te following example: Date1 - Date2 This does not give me the difference this gives me a weird date value. If you want to calculate the difference between two time in HH:MM:SS. Any idea of how I could get past that? Go to Solution. Here we will see the power bi date difference between the two in the same column in power bi. I need to find the time difference in Hours:Minutes between the selected values. Diff = IF (Table1 [Column1]